Etymology[edit]

jelly +‎ -ish

Adjective[edit]

jellyish (comparative more jellyish, superlative most jellyish)

  1. Resembling or characteristic of jelly; jellylike.
    • 1940, Lancelot Hogben, Principles of Animal Biology:
      In both man and the frog the thyroid gland consists of small capsules of a jellyish material and is very richly supplied with blood vessels (Fig. 61).
